Here's another view of the super pet cages.  We have only one ferret but
for some reason decided to buy her the deluxe cage.  We have the 4 story
super pet cage complete with tubes to climb from floor to floor (we removed
the wheels to allow her a ramp into the cage).  Our little girl loves the
cage.  At first she was tentative about climbing from floor to floor but
after a few days she traveled from top to bottom in record times.  Her bed
is hanging on the top.  We have old towels on each of the floors to allow
her a nap where she sees fit (it's almost always on the top floor).  The
litter plan problem was easy to solve.  We purchased a cat pan that fits
perfectly on the bottom floor with plenty of room for a J type self feeder
and a large water bottle.  She always uses the pan.
 
Oh, we added one extra thing.  Each floor except the bottom has carpet
inlays.  Indoor-outdoor carpet works great.  Once in a while she decides to
redecorate her home, but that's part of the fun.  She knows she has to
potty before the bottom door is opened to freedom.  We occasionally wash
the bedding to keep the ferret scent to a minimum.  After seeing other
cages, we would not want to trade.  WE HAVE THE BEST!
